THIS JUST IN! My long awaited bottle of Shalimar Souffle d'Oranger has arrived and she is a wonderous fragrance for spring. Naturally, bias toward the ever contemplated note of Neroli may well affect my judgement; however in true Guerlain style, there is nothing understated about Souffle d'Oranger.

Shalimar Souffle d'Oranger is yet another niche forged from the recent reformulation of Guerlain's long time hallmark fragrance, Shalimar. Though most Guerlain lovers know well enough that today's Shalimar is not yesterday's Shalimar. In fact, I do not sense much adherance to the new Shalimar in Souffle d'Oranger either, excepting the epic fan shaped bottle of the epoch Eau de Cologne. If one were to judge this fragrance on packaging alone, Souffle d'Oranger could never disappoint; though there is little disappointing in the fragrance itself.

Shalimar Souffle d'Oranger is however, a close skin scent. It is not the type of perfume which will bowl over everyone in the room as you enter. But it is effortlessly classy. It begins with a knockout Bergamote and Pettit Grain combination, green and gargantuan, then swiftly softens into a creamy white floral in lieu of it's namesake. The orange blossom neroli notes are as creamy and dreamy as the blossoms of an orange tree in the warm days of early summer, when the pollen is ripe and the bees buzz lazily from flower to flower.

The fragrance turns then to a slightly powdery warm and soft rendition of that summer bloom, and this is where the subtle spice reminsicent of Shalimar shines through ever so gently. It's the drydown in this one which holds it best aspect and although the sillage is not epic, the longevity is a little better, sticking around strongly for about four hours.

From the annals of time, Royal Apothic stems from a business minded discovery of an old 'apothecary manual' in a book shop in London. Indeed, Royal Apothic seems like it might well factor into a byline from the movie Notting Hill. Their line of fragrances are in no way less fantastical. Field Poppy was part of their first collection 'Conservatories' released in the department store chain 'Anthropologie' in the US, but shelved after 2012.

Field Poppy has a lovely woody earthiness to it, it is in fact a Floral Woody Musk according to its profile. And though the notes are characterised as being linear, the fragrance itself has a wonderful depth as it dries down into a sweet floral greeness, epitomising its name as it captures the image of a field of poppy flowers. Imagine a luminous golden sun shining its rays down upon you, warming the green earth all around you. The world suddenly becomes a study in pastels, a landscape stretches itself beneath an oak frame, life becomes ultimately picturesque.

Royal Apothic fragrances contain between a 15 and 20% concentration of perfume oils, their sillage is wide and the longevity is infinite. In spite of their brilliance and unparalleled quality, Royal Apothic fragrances are typically hard to aquire, Field Poppy has been discontinued for some time, but the beautifully crafted bottle housed in its oakwood box wrapped in muslin cloth still carries the same characteristics it held when I bought it many moons ago.

Eau, Lo**ta! What a delicious mix this fragrance is. I would veer towards calling this fragrance unique, but it holds so much in common with Lola by Marc Jacobs, that it would be silly of me to say this fragrance is at all individual; and yet it is! Si Lo**ta might well constitute all the attributes of a 'dupe' as far as its shared DNA with the sadly discontinued Lola is concerned, there is a woodiness to it which somehow reminds me of the sweet scent of pencil shavings from my highschool pencil case, my fixation of which was both confusing and bemusing among those adolescent discoveries of what illicited my particular attention.

It is perhaps the citrus in Si Lo**ta's composition which deems it different. Aside from that, the notes are very similar to Lola. Like Lola, this fragrance is beautifully blended, innovatively, there is a sweetness to it but it is never overpowering and no single element stands alone from first spray to dry down. And that dry down is to die for!

Let us hope that Si Lo**ta remains upon the LL repertoire without being harrassed by reformulation as the Lo**ta Lempicka original has suffered. Like the first Lo**ta Lempicka and its glass apple, the bottle is beautifully crafted and unlike anything else on earth. A four leaf clover with gilded edges and a tiny chiffon accent, as if the entire bottle represents a stylish Parisian woman who wears nothing but her favourite scarf and yet feels she is perfectly 'dressed'.

Spring has come baring gifts; she is 'Ostara' and she is the goddess of earthly beauty and renewal. On this fine day drenched in sun, Ostara has come into her own. You might catch her with bees buzzing about her, her head bobbing in the light breeze. You may even sense her brilliance as you look upon the flowers which have now revealed themselves after months of their being hidden beneath the ground.

Ostara captures perfectly those sunny yellow blooms as they present themselves to us in the warm weather. In fact, Ostara is a photo real representation of the Daffodil and the Jonquill, complete with a veil of morning dew and the fresh wet earth at their feet.

Penhaligon's Ostara is quite literally named for the Goddess of Sping, the truth of which becomes very apparent upon the lightest of sprays. The golden juice within the standard Penhaligon's London shaped bottle seems as if it could be the result of some magical nymph and her desire to capture for perpetuity the scent of spring into a bottle. The floral notes are entirely realistic and one might easily swoon from her arrow pointed accuracy.

Although Ostara is an Eau de Toilette, her longevity is eternal and much like the flowers she represents, those yellow floral notes have a very wide sillage. It is a shame this fragrance has been discontinued, because the scent might easily fill the void for nature lovers trapped in their houses all winter long.
